Output 42392b29cab152a4a718d415a37954589701afb00969bbf00698d8fc00f1d6b0:1

value
53653000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23c1adae29a91d30bf9665b7c11c56b8be77f6f7 OP_EQUAL
address
MBADuA85vyWCrtumhTwyHy5gHNXAf7PwsC
transaction
42392b29cab152a4a718d415a37954589701afb00969bbf00698d8fc00f1d6b0
spent
true